Best Things To Do near Sofie's restaurant Bar and Grill
Discover the best experiences near Sofie's restaurant Bar and Grill. Find inspiration for your trip with our curated list of top-rated spots, local favorites, and hidden gems.
More about Sofie's restaurant Bar and Grill
Discover delightful dining at Sofie's Restaurant Bar and Grill in Nevis - where local flavors meet international cuisine in a vibrant atmosphere.
Tell me more about Sofie's restaurant Bar and Grill